Choosing the Right Fabric

When it comes to sewing a halter neck crop top, selecting the right fabric is essential. Consider the drape, weight, and stretch of the fabric to ensure a comfortable fit and a flattering silhouette. Lightweight and breathable fabrics such as cotton, linen, or rayon are popular choices for summer tops. If you’re looking for a more formal or structured look, fabrics like satin or crepe can add a touch of elegance to your crop top. Additionally, consider the print or pattern of the fabric to complement your personal style and the overall aesthetic you want to achieve.

When shopping for fabric, don’t forget to purchase lining material if necessary. Lining fabric can provide additional structure and prevent the top from being too sheer. Opt for a lining fabric that matches the main fabric or choose a contrasting color for a unique touch. Before starting your project, make sure to pre-wash and iron your fabric to prevent any shrinkage or distortion after sewing.

Measuring and Cutting the Fabric

Before you start cutting your fabric, take accurate measurements to ensure a perfect fit for your halter neck crop top. Measure your bust, waist, and hips, as well as the length from your shoulder to your desired crop top length. Add seam allowances to your measurements, typically ⅝ inch is a standard allowance, although you can adjust this to your preference.

To create the front and back pieces of the crop top, fold your main fabric in half lengthwise, making sure the right sides are facing each other. Place your pattern or template on the fabric, aligning it with the fold. Carefully trace around the pattern and cut along the lines. Repeat this process for the lining fabric if you are using one.

Once you have cut out the front and back pieces, it’s time to cut the straps. Measure and cut two long strips of fabric, around 2 inches wide and your desired length for the straps. Keep in mind that the length of the straps will determine how high or low the halter neckline sits on your chest.

Constructing the Crop Top

With all your fabric pieces cut out, it’s time to start sewing your halter neck crop top. Begin by sewing the front and back pieces together at the side seams. Place the front and back pieces right sides together and pin along the sides. Sew using a straight stitch, securing the stitches at the beginning and end.

Next, it’s time to attach the straps. Take one strap and fold it in half lengthwise, with the right sides facing each other. Sew along the long edge, leaving the short ends open. Repeat this process for the other strap. Once both straps are sewn, turn them inside out using a safety pin or a turning tool. Press the straps with an iron for a crisp finish.

To attach the straps to the crop top, align one end of each strap with the top corners of the back piece. Pin the straps in place, making sure they are evenly spaced. Sew the straps securely to the back piece, reinforcing the stitches for added durability.

Finishing Touches

With the main construction of the halter neck crop top complete, it’s time to add those finishing touches. Hem the bottom edge of the crop top by folding it under twice and sewing along the edge. This will give the top a clean and polished finish. You can also hem the armholes if desired, following the same method.

If you want to add a closure to the back of the crop top, consider using buttons, snaps, or hook-and-eye fasteners. Attach the closure according to the manufacturer’s instructions, making sure it is secure and functional.

Once you have completed all the sewing, give your halter neck crop top a final press with an iron to remove any wrinkles or creases. Try on your creation and make any necessary adjustments to ensure the perfect fit. Now, you’re ready to show off your stylish and handmade halter neck crop top!

2. How do I take accurate measurements for sewing a halter neck crop top?

Accurate measurements are crucial for sewing a well-fitted halter neck crop top. Start by measuring your bust, waist, and hip circumference. You’ll also need to measure the length from your neck to where you want the crop top to end.

To measure your bust, wrap the measuring tape around the fullest part of your chest. For the waist, measure the narrowest part of your midsection. And for the hips, measure the widest part of your lower body. These measurements will help you determine the size and shape of the pattern pieces you’ll need to cut.

3. What sewing techniques are used for creating a halter neck crop top?

Creating a halter neck crop top involves using various sewing techniques to achieve a professional-looking finish. Some of the common techniques used include:

– Sewing darts: Darts are used to shape the fabric and create a flattering fit. They are often found at the bust and waist areas of the crop top.

– Hemming: Hemming is essential to give your crop top a clean and polished look. You can choose to hem the edges with a sewing machine or use a rolled hem technique for a more delicate finish.

– Attaching straps: The halter neck straps need to be securely attached to the main body of the crop top. This can be done using sewing machine stitches or hand stitching.

– Adding closures: Depending on the design of your halter neck crop top, you may need to add closures such as buttons, snaps, or hooks. These closures ensure a secure and comfortable fit.
